Healthy RESTAURANTS, Juice Bars & Smoothies, Bowls Restaurants
26917 Sierra Hwy Newhall, CA 91321 USA
661-299-4442
Juice It Up! is a juice bar in Newhall, CA serving hand-crafted smoothies, acai bowls, fresh pressed, raw fruit and vegetable juice blends.... Read more >